文档介绍:实验1 单片机开发系统及使用
实验目的
1. 了解单片机开发系统的基本功能,掌握单片机开发系统的使用方法。
2. 通过对典型程序的调试操作训练,掌握运用开发系统快速有效地进行调试的基本方法。
3. 熟悉单片机仿真开发系统的使用方法,掌握其基本功能与操作过程。
设备
全套计算机系统(计算机、键盘、鼠标、显示器、程序烧写器
实验原理
MedWin集成开发软件介绍
对于不同的单片机开发系统,调试软件和调试环境也有所不同,例如:MICE-51型单片机开发系统是在DOS环境下通过MBUG调试软件进行录入、编辑、汇编及调试。Insight系列的Me-52A型是在Windows环境下通过MedWin集成开发软件完成各项编程与调试任务,它们的基本功能大致相同。本书以MedWin集成开发软件的使用为例,介绍开发系统的使用步骤和调试方法。
(1)开发系统和目标板连接好,并接上电源。
(2)启动MedWin中文版,初次启动出现图(a)所示窗口,再次启动出现图(b)所示窗口。
(a) (b)
单击“取消”或“模拟仿真”进入MedWin集成开发环境,出现图(c)所示界面。
(3)设置汇编(或编译)环境。第一次在MedWin中使用汇编语言汇编(C51编译)环境需进行“编译/汇编/连接配置”(以后使用不需再配置了)。单击“设置”菜单项,如图(d)所示。选择“设置向导”,弹出如图(e)所示的“编译/汇编/连接配置”窗口。
单击“下一步”按钮,弹出如图(f)所示的窗口,在该窗口中设置系统头文件路径和系统库文件路径。选择源程序扩展名为ASM(或C),若采用汇编语言编制源程序,应选择ASM,然后按“完成”按钮即可。
(c)集成开发环境界面(d) 设置菜单项
(e) (f)
编译、汇编、连接配置窗口
(4)新建NEW(或打开Open)文件。在图(c)中单击“文件”选项,出现图(g)所示菜单,选择“新建”(或“打开”)文件,出现图(h)新建文件界面,选择文件存放路径,输入文件名,单击打开。(或在WINDOWS和DOS环境下编辑的源程序),如:××.ASM。编制源程序时,可在每条指令的后面加必要的文字注释,但注释前须用分号间隔。若用C语言编制源程序时,文件名应为××.C。
(5)对源程序进行汇编(或编译)。源程序编好后,在图(c)中单击“项目管理”,如图(i)所示。选择“编译/汇编”菜单项(或Ctrl+F7)对当前的源程序进行“编译/汇编”。若采用汇编语言编制源文件,将对当前文件进行汇编。若采用C语言编制源文件,将对当前文件进行编译。
(g)文件处理菜单项(h)新建文件界面
(i)项目管理菜单
(6)排除错误。文件经过“编译/汇编”后,在消息窗口将会出现纠错信息,该信息将提示错误出现的位置及错误的类型和数量等,使用者可根据该信息对源程序的错误进行纠正,纠正后再重新进行“编译/汇编”直至错误信息数量为“0”。
(7)产生代码并装入仿真器。在图(i)所示“项目管理”菜单栏中选择“产生代码并装入”菜单项(或Ctrl+F8),将生成的文件代码装入(Load)单片机开发系统的仿真RAM中。
(8)调试程序。产生代码并装入仿真器完成后,在图(c)中单击“调试”,如图(j)所